python_examples: Reformatted, self-checking, executable
* Moved body of each python example to main. This allows for basic load module testing for CI * General cleanup of python modules (crlf/tabs/prints/etc) * Chmod'ed to 755 to allow running examples without specifying the python interpreter * Added ctest for loading python2/3 modules * Added jniclasscode pragma for java swig interface files. * Updated check_examplenames.py module to check all languages vs. a cxx example name * Added tests for checking python module and test loading * Added 'make test' to travis-ci run (run ctests) * Print a more meaningful message when not building cxx docs into python modules * Updated check_clean.py to only check java wrapper files * ENABLED ctests for UPM * Deleted using_carrays.py python example - this is covered by other examples Signed-off-by: Noel Eck <noel.eck@intel.com>
